Spring has sprung!

Tomorrow is the first day of spring, and this year the housing market might not be as daunting for buyers and sellers, according to a new report.

The number of homes for sale has been steadily decreasing, helping list prices stabilize and giving both buyers and sellers a little more confidence in the market.  Overall, national inventories have dropped more than 20 percent since last year, according to a Realtor.com report, and houses are staying on the market for shorter periods.  List prices are looking up, too, rising almost 7 percent since last February.  This is great news for both buyers and sellers alike!

In Gwinnett County these statistics are especially true, where there have been 1,623 closings so far in 2012.  With interest rates at an all-time low and amazing deals everywhere you look, many buyers are taking advantage of this spring market.  We are also seeing more and more sellers listing their homes lately, even though they may be competing with foreclosure and short sales.  If a home looks good and is priced right, it will sell.

Considering a short sale? We can help!

If you are behind on your mortgage payments for any reason, or if you expect to have problems paying your mortgage in the future, we can help.  The Hill Wood Home Team is experienced with every aspect of the short sale process and we will work directly with your lender to find a solution now.

What exactly is a short sale you ask?  It is a transaction where the lenders agree to accept less than the mortgage amount owed by the current homeowner, in lieu of foreclosure.  There are many reasons homeowners may choose to do a short sale on their home.  Some fall on hard times either due to a job loss, divorce, or medical situation, which then causes them to fall behind on their mortgage payments.  Others may want to sell their home either because of a job transfer or the need for a larger or smaller home, and the amount they owe on the home is significantly less than what their home will sell for in today’s market.  If the net proceeds from the sale won’t cover the total mortgage obligation and closing costs, and you don’t have the funds to cover the difference, then a short sale may be your best option.

What is the NSP Program?

The NSP Program or The Neighborhood Stabilization Program was established under HUD to help stabilize communities that have suffered from foreclosures or abandonment.  A second objective of the NSP Program is to provide affordable housing to eligible low, moderate, and middle income homebuyers.  A Housing and Recovery Act was signed into law in 2008 to address the severe housing crisis, allocating $3.92 billion in grant funds under the NSP Program.  These funds allow local governments to purchase and redevelop foreclosed properties in areas with the greatest need.

Gwinnett County received approximately $10.5 million from HUD, as well as approximately $3 million from the Georgia Department of Community Affairs.  Available NSP homes are priced from $70,000 to just under $200,000 and are located throughout Gwinnett County.  Some of these homes were previously foreclosed and have been updated and finished into move-in ready homes, while others may have never been lived in at all.

NSP Homebuyers will receive up to $22,500 towards the purchase of their new home which may be used to lower the sales price, towards the down payment, or for closing costs.  The purchaser must meet certain qualifications including qualifying for a 30 year fixed FHA loan, completing an 8 hour HUD home owners class, and they must occupy the home as their primary residence.  There are also income levels which must be met.  For a family of 2, the maximum household income for all persons in the household must not exceed $66,550, and for a family of 4 the maximum is $83,150.

Why buying a foreclosure may be a good option for you

There are many reasons why buying a foreclosure may make sense for you and your family, including low price, flexible financing, and profitability to name a few.

The most common discount you will find on a home that has gone into foreclosure is about 5-10 percent below the true market value.  However, this price can be lowered as much as 30-50 percent depending on the property and how long it has been on the market.  In any case, you will be able to purchase the property for a lot less than most re-sales or new construction.  Also, because most foreclosures are so inexpensive, they are a good option for re-sale, equity building, renting, or other investment purposes.  Since most foreclosures require repairs or renovations, many buyers choose to go this route so they can remodel the home to their own tastes.  Whether you decide to stay in the house for years, or flip it quickly to make a profit, you stand to gain financially.

If you are looking for a home you can move into quickly, a foreclosure may be a good option for you.  Most banks that sell foreclosures are in a hurry to get rid of these homes, making them more willing to accept lower offers, consider different financing options, contribute to closing costs, etc.  Since most foreclosures are already vacant, there is no waiting for the current owners to pack up before you can move into your new home.

No matter what type of home you choose to buy, there are always arguments for and against every choice.  Though the market continues to get better, there is still a large amount of foreclosures going up every day, and a lot of inventory for a smart buyer to choose from.  As long as you do your research, and choose a great Realtor to help you in the process, you will land on top.

Working with a Realtor will save you time and money!

The idea of buying a home may seem like an easy task.  Simply determine what type of home you want, the area you would like to live in, and how much you are willing to pay.  You then search on a few websites, make an offer, get it accepted, sign some papers,  and move into your dream home.   If only it were that easy!

Tha reality is that buying a home encompasses a lot more than those few steps and may be much more complicated than you realized.  That is why it’s imperative for you to seek a real estate professional to help on your journey to home ownership.

In the area of financing alone, buying a home has a lot of factors to take into account.  By having a Realtor ask you a few questions about your available savings, income, and current debt, they can refer you to a lender best qualified to fit your needs.  Our team has lenders that can approve someone with a credit score as low as 580, as well as lenders who are knowledgable of all current down payment assistance programs!

Once you have established your buying power as well as the type of home you would like to purchase, your Realtor will help you during the search process while showing you all available homes in the area which match your criteria.  When it’s time to make an offer, there are many factors your Realtor will take into account when negotiating the best price possible for you.  These include price, financing, terms, date of possession, and often the inclusion or exclusion of repairs or items in the home.

Once all parties have agreed to the terms, you will be under contract on your new home.  At this point, your Realtor will advise you on what inspections are necessary and also recommends licensed inspectors to use.  Once all inspections have passed, the appraisal has been completed, and there has been a clear title pulled on the home, your Realtor will guide you through the closing process to make sure everything is as smooth as possible.
